Eurofighter GmbH

Eurofighter Jagdflugzeug GmbH is a multinational company which is tasked with co-ordinating the design, production and upgrade of the Eurofighter Typhoon.

The company is made up of the major aerospace companies of the four Eurofighter partner nations. The company is based and registered in Germany.

Eurofighter GmbH's customer is the NATO Eurofighter and Tornado Management Agency (NETMA), operating on behalf of the partner nations. This collaborative managmement model follows that of the Tornado programme closely, in that case Panavia Aircraft GmbH is responsible for delivering the weapon system, and the UK registered Turbo Union Ltd. is responsible for the propulsion system.
